WebYour blood pressure is considered high if the reading is more than 140/90mmHg. Blood pressure over this level puts you at higher risk of having a heart attack or stroke (cardiovascular disease). This is true whether the first number (systolic) is higher than 140, or the second number (diastolic) is higher than 90, or both. Web19 jan. 2024 · High blood pressure, also known as hypertension, is usually defined as having a sustained blood pressure of 140/90mmHg or above. The line between normal and raised blood pressure is not fixed and depends on your individual circumstances. Web27 jan. 2024 · Yes, hypertension is a VA disability and can be rated at 10%, 20%, 40%, or 60% depending upon the frequency, severity, and duration of your symptoms. Hypertension or “High Blood Pressure” is rated under CFR 38, Part 4, VA Schedule of Ratings, Diseases of the Arteries and Veins, Diagnostic Code 7101.
Web19 jul. 2024 · The proportion of adults with uncontrolled high blood pressure increased with age―from 10% or less among 18–34 year-olds (10% for men and 4.9% for women) to a peak of 47% at age 85 and over (51% for men and 48% for women).
